Job Description

We are seeking a detail-oriented and organized Accounting Technician to join a finance team here in Greenville, NC. In this role, you will perform a variety of routine-to-complex clerical and accounting tasks to support a daily financial operation. Primary responsibilities will include managing accounts payable/receivable, reconciling bank statements, and maintaining accurate financial records.

Key Responsibilities

  • Accounts Payable (AP) & Receivable (AR): Process vendor invoices, verify expense reports, issue payments, and generate client invoices. Manage collections and vendor relations professionally.
  • Data Entry & Ledger Maintenance: Accurately input financial transactions into a designated accounting software. Maintain well-organized digital and physical financial files.
  • Reconciliations: Perform monthly bank, credit card, and general ledger reconciliations to ensure all financial data balances.
  • Financial Reporting & Month-End: Assist with month-end and year-end closing processes, including the preparation of basic financial statements and spreadsheets.
  • Compliance & Audit Prep: Ensure all transactions comply with local, state, and federal regulations. Gather documentation for internal or external audits.
